## v2.4.1 — Alertmux Dedup

Changed fingerprint hashing to include alert source cluster. Previously, identical alerts from separate clusters at Vantorp collapsed into one page, masking multi-region incidents. Dedup window reduced from 10m to 5m. Suppressed-alert counts now exported to the Grivver dashboard. New team members: read the dedup runbook before touching fingerprint rules. Rollback path tested in staging. Questions on this change go to the engineer below.

account owner for bawip-tahag: Raleth Quenok

## Changelog — v4.2.0: Snapshot Defaults Changed

Snapshot testing in Pinfold UI now diffs rendered DOM instead of serialized trees. Obsolete snapshots fail CI instead of warning. Update threshold loosened for antialiasing noise; animation frames frozen by default. Existing suites must regenerate baselines once — budget ~20 min in the release window. No API changes. New defaults shipped with this release are as follows.

deployment values, bafog-tajop:
NOVAEL_PIN=7103
NOVAEL_TENANT=weneth
NOVAEL_METRICS_HOST=metrics.novael.crelvocorp.corp
NOVAEL_SEAL=seal_be72a3d3
NOVAEL_STANDBY_TEAM=caseth

## Fieldnote Offline Mode

When Fieldnote surveyors lose coverage, the app switches to offline capture automatically and queues entries in local storage. Support should confirm the device shows the amber banner before escalating sync complaints. Queued records upload in batch once connectivity returns; conflicts are resolved server-side by timestamp. Do not instruct users to clear app data, as that wipes the queue. Manual sync can be forced from the diagnostics screen. The offline subsystem runs with the following configuration values.

settings of yageg-yahap:
[gorael]
team = olieth
access_code = ac_941d74
owner = brieth.aldiel
host = gorael.tolvaqio.internal
port = 6379
peer = briwyn.urlaqtech.internal
salt = 116e6622
pin = 1957